Briefing — Leadership Review: Currency-Hedging Decision

Prepared for department heads.

Following sustained volatility in the markets where Orvane Group sources components, Treasury proposes hedging 70% of next year's foreign-currency exposure via forward contracts, up from 45%. Estimated cost is modest relative to the downside protection gained. Finance will present scenarios at the review session. The strategic assumptions underpinning this recommendation are set out below.

board note of bawep-tajef: Queniusek Systems plans to raise the Quenvan list price by 53.1 percent in March. The pricing group signed off on a budget of $176.4 million for Project Drueth. The renewal with Casionix Partners closes at $142.5 million a year, 8.3 percent below the last contract. Project Fraax slips by six weeks because of the tooling delay.

## Tracing requests across services

If your plugin calls anything downstream of the Wombatry gateway, you need to propagate the trace headers — otherwise your spans show up orphaned in Glimmerport and everyone will ask you why. The collector samples aggressively in prod, so don't be surprised if low-traffic plugins rarely appear. Test in the sandbox cluster first, where sampling is wide open. The tracing configuration the sandbox runs with is shown below.

service settings:
[casax]
port = 6379
team = rusir
host = casax.zemvarhq.corp
region = outer-4
access_code = ac_9808ce
timeout_ms = 1500

The garage occupancy feed for the Brindlewood campus arrives over a message queue every thirty seconds, one record per level, published by the Stallgrid edge boxes. Counts can briefly go negative when a sensor double-fires on exit; the ingest job clamps these to zero and flags the interval. If the feed stalls for more than five minutes, the dashboard falls back to the last known snapshot. Sensor mappings, queue names, and the replay procedure are documented on the internal page below.

runbook for tahog-kadug: https://gitlab.qirvanworks.corp/projects/pages/view/b139298aed28